Word Word Type Definition
Infield v. t. To inclose, as a field.
Infield n. Arable and manured land kept continually under crop; --
distinguished from outfield.
Infield n. The diamond; -- opposed to outfield. See Diamond, n., 5.

There was a time when rival teams used a shift against me. They would put the second baseman on the shortstop's side of the bag, move the shortstop into the hole to his right, and have the third baseman hug the foul line. The idea was to build an infield wall against a known right-handed pull hitter.
Harmon Killebrew
